Concentrate cleaning tablets β small dissolvable pucks you drop into a reusable spray bottle or appliance β have become a popular alternative to shipping pre-mixed liquid cleaners. The pitch is straightforward: less plastic, less shipping weight, one format instead of a cabinet of specialty bottles. Here's what to look for in this category, plus our two current picks.
How Concentrate Tablets Work
A cleaning tablet packs the active cleaning agents β typically some combination of surfactants, oxidizers, and enzymes β into a compressed, water-soluble form. You dissolve it in the recommended amount of water, and the resulting solution functions like a standard spray cleaner. The environmental pitch (less packaging, lower shipping weight) is straightforward and verifiable; the cleaning performance depends on the specific formulation, which varies by brand and product.
What to Check Before Buying
- Published ingredients. A brand willing to list its actual formulation (surfactants, oxidizers, specific enzymes) gives you more to evaluate than one that only describes results in marketing language.
- What surfaces it's actually formulated for β general multi-surface cleaners and appliance-specific cleaners (like washing machine tablets) use different active ingredients for different jobs.
- A real guarantee, since cleaning performance is one of the easier claims to test for yourself once the product arrives.
